Flange form filling transformer insulator
Technical field
The utility model relates to High-Voltage Electrical Appliances field of components, particularly a kind of flange form filling transformer insulator.
Background technology
Porcelain shell for transformer is the primary insulation device outside transformer tank, and the lead-out wire of Transformer Winding has to pass through insulated porcelain sleeve, makes to insulate between lead-out wire and between lead-out wire and transformer case, plays fixing lead-out wire simultaneously.Because electric pressure is different, insulated porcelain sleeve has the forms such as true procelain cover, oil-filled insulator and electric capacity insulator.Oil-filled insulator is multiplex, and at 35kV level transformer, it is oil-filled at insulator, and in insulator, wear a conducting rod, conducting rod is provided with binding post.At present, the flange form filling transformer insulator of prior art has following point: conducting rod and gap between insulator larger, cannot realize good location between conducting rod and insulator, conducting rod can produce rotation, the unbalance stress of hermetically-sealed construction can be caused, thus affect the sealing of product.
Summary of the invention
Technical problem to be solved in the utility model is: provide that circumferential limit effect between a kind of conducting rod and insulator is better, product sealing effectiveness better flange form filling transformer insulator.
The technical scheme in the invention for solving the above technical problem is: a kind of flange form filling transformer insulator, comprise sleeve pipe, the conducting rod of inner chamber that fit is installed on sleeve pipe and the binding post that is fixed on conducting rod, the top of described conducting rod is fixedly connected on insulator upper end by least one nut; Described conducting rod is provided with position limiting convex ring, and described insulator inner chamber is provided with limited step, is provided with cushion pad between described position limiting convex ring and described limited step; The top of described limited step is provided with at least one location notch, and described conducting rod periphery is provided with and realizes the spacing alignment pin of circumference for matching with described location notch.
Compared with prior art, the utility model has the advantage of: the conducting rod of this flange form filling transformer insulator is provided with position limiting convex ring, and insulator inner chamber is provided with limited step, is provided with cushion pad between position limiting convex ring and limited step; The top of limited step is provided with at least one location notch, and conducting rod periphery is provided with and realizes the spacing alignment pin of circumference for matching with location notch.Like this, be provided with cushion pad between position limiting convex ring and limited step, axial limiting can be realized well, good location can be realized by alignment pin and arranging between conducting rod and insulator inner chamber of location notch, conducting rod not easily produces and rotates in a circumferential direction, and better can ensure the sealing effectiveness of product.
As preferably, the bottom fit of described sleeve pipe is provided with flange, and is provided with silastic-layer between described flange and described sleeve pipe periphery.Like this, flange is more convenient by the fixed installation of silastic-layer.
As preferably, the inner surface of described flange is provided with the jog matched with described silastic-layer of multiple continuous setting, and the bottom of described sleeve pipe is provided with the one wave part for matching with described silastic-layer.Like this, the fixed effect between silastic-layer and flange and sleeve pipe is better.
As preferably, between described nut and conducting rod, be provided with the sealant beads for sealing.Like this, sealing effectiveness is better.
As preferably, the bottom of described nut is also provided with trim ring, and is provided with sealing gasket before described trim ring and described sleeve upper end face.Like this, sealing effectiveness is better.

Embodiment
Below in conjunction with accompanying drawing, embodiment of the present utility model is further described.
As shown in Figure 1, 2, a kind of flange form filling transformer insulator, comprise sleeve pipe 1, conducting rod 2 that fit is installed on the inner chamber of sleeve pipe 1 and the binding post 8 that is fixed on conducting rod 2, the top of described conducting rod 2 is fixedly connected on insulator upper end by least one nut 9; It is characterized in that: described conducting rod 2 is provided with position limiting convex ring 2.1, described insulator inner chamber is provided with limited step, is provided with cushion pad 3 between described position limiting convex ring 2.1 and described limited step; The top of described limited step is provided with at least one location notch 1.1, and described conducting rod 2 periphery is provided with and realizes the spacing alignment pin 4 of circumference for matching with described location notch 1.1.
The bottom fit of described sleeve pipe 1 is provided with flange 10, and is provided with silastic-layer 11 between described flange 10 and described sleeve pipe 1 periphery.
The jog 10.1 matched with described silastic-layer 11 that the inner surface of described flange 10 is provided with multiple continuous setting, and the bottom of described sleeve pipe 1 is provided with the one wave part 1.2 for matching with described silastic-layer 11.
The sealant beads 7 for sealing is provided with between described nut 9 and conducting rod 2.
The bottom of described nut 9 is also provided with trim ring 6, and is provided with sealing gasket 5 before described trim ring 6 and described sleeve pipe 1 upper surface.
